About Dr. David Westenberg

Dr. David Westenberg of Rolla, Curators’ Distinguished Teaching Professor of biological sciences at Missouri S&T, has been S&T’s faculty athletics representative since 2013. He served for over 10 years as S&T’s pre-medical advisor participated in the NCAA Faculty Athletics Representative Fellows program, and was a finalist for the 2018 NCAA Dave Pariser Faculty Mentor Award. In addition to research and teaching, Westenberg is co-advisor of the Missouri S&T iGEM synthetic biology student organization and advisor for the Missouri S&T Chapter of the National Society for Leadership and Success. He has received numerous awards for teaching and service including the inaugural College of Arts, Sciences, and Education Dean’s Medal in 2021, the University of Missouri System President’s Award for Community Engagement in 2020, and the American Society for Microbiology Carski Award for teaching and student success in 2020.
